Book Synopsis
This edited volume spans the latest developments and applications in a new and exciting field of spectroscopy - Fourier Transform Infra-Red (FTIR) spectroscopy.

Table of Contents
Theoretical Analyses of the Amide I Infrared Bands of GlobularProteins (H. Torii & M. Tasumi).

Fourier Transform Infrared Spectroscopy of Enzyme Systems (J.Alben).

Light-Induced Fourier Transform Infrared Difference Spectroscopy ofthe Primary Electron Donor in Photosynthetic Reaction Centers (E.Nabedryk).

Equipment: Slow and Fast Infrared Kinetic Studies (F.Siebert).

Ultrafast Infrared Spectroscopy of Biomolecules (B. Cohen & R.Hochstrasser).

Infrared Spectroscopy of Nucleic Acids (J. Liquier & E.Taillandier).

Fourier Transform Infrared Spectroscopy in the Study of HydratedLipids and Lipid Bilayer Membranes (R. Lewis & R.McElhaney).

Fourier Transform Infrared Spectroscopic Studies of Cell SurfacePolysaccharides (K. Brandenburg & U. Seydel).

Fourier Transform Infrared Spectroscopy of Biomembrane Systems (P.Haris & D. Chapman).

What Can Infrared Spectroscopy Tell Us About the Structure andComposition of Intact Bacterial Cells?

(D. Naumann, et al.).

Biomedical Infrared Spectroscopy (M. Jackson & H.Mantsch).

New Trends in Isotope-Edited Infrared Spectroscopy (H. Fabian, etal.).

Index.
